AlphaGo (2017)
Description: This documentary follows the development of the AlphaGo AI, which uses neural networks to master the ancient game of Go, challenging the world's best player. It's an inspiring tale of human vs. machine intelligence.
Fact: The film captures the historic match between AlphaGo and Lee Sedol, showcasing the emotional and intellectual journey of both the AI and its human opponent.


The Great Hack (2019)
Description: While not exclusively about neural networks, this documentary explores how data and AI, including neural networks, were used to manipulate elections, highlighting the ethical dilemmas of AI in politics.
Fact: The film features Brittany Kaiser, a former Cambridge Analytica employee, who provides insider insights into the company's practices.
